In This Training

Sterilization is a permanent contraceptive option for many women and men. Because of its permanence, it is essential that cleints receive client-centered counseling to ensure fully informed decisions about this method. This workshop will cover counseling requirements for family planning staff that provide sterilization counseling.

By the end of this session, participants will be able to:

  • Explain the benefits and potential complications of tubal ligation and vasectomy
  • Define the Title X guidelines for informed consent for sterilization counseling
  • Describe strategies for minimizing possible regret in clients opting for sterilization
  • Practice how to conduct client-centered counseling
